A stunning example of early Victorian pottery. The Victorians loved the blue & white "Willow" pattern, which has held its own and remainds a popular and timeless design. The back has no markings to confirm.who made this piece. Markings were not required until 1885. Based on this and the glaze that has worn from the back showing earthenware, it is likely this piece is early Victorian. Further examples of.its age are crazing, some fading of the colour and the odd small chip. None of this takes away from the beauty of the piece. It is possible it could even be from the Georgian period, however it would be impossible to say for certain! Dimensions 33 x 26cm...more
